> File is under version-control; use C-x v v to check in/out
> This message is misleading if not wrong as most of the version control
> tools do not use read-only to indicate their status.
Check in/out used to be bound to C-x C-q (because back then, most of the
version control tools did use read-only to indicate their status), so
the above message is there to remind people who have C-x C-q hardcoded
in their fingers that maybe they really meant to type C-x v v.
